Learjet 60

Overview

U.S. registered Learjet 60, MSN 60-245, operated in the Jacksonville, FL area; listed on charter/operator pages and spotting records with recent interior/exterior refresh noted.

Specifications

  • Engines: 2× Pratt & Whitney Canada PW305A (4679 lbf each)
  • Seats: 8

Operations & Cabin

8‑place executive layout (refurbished interior reported 2021) Interior and exterior refurbishment reported in 2021; executive club seating for eight and standard Learjet 60 cabin amenities reported in charter listings. Avionics: Rockwell Collins Pro Line 21 (as listed in broker/charter equipment descriptions)

Model & Market Context

This article describes airframe N851GV, a 2002-build Learjet 60 bearing serial number 60-245 and registered in the US. The aircraft is owned by Benedictus Holdings LLC, a corporation based in Jacksonville, FL, US, and has been reported in operator and broker listings with activity tied to that owner. A refurbished interior was reported in 2021, and broker/charter equipment descriptions list a modern avionics fit. Notable registry actions beyond ownership and the 2021 interior report are not published.

The cabin of N851GV is configured in an 8‑place executive layout, matching the listed seat count, and the interior was refurbished in 2021 according to reports. Avionics are cited in broker and charter equipment descriptions as Rockwell Collins Pro Line 21, supporting typical business-jet navigation and communications suites for operator missions. Based from Jacksonville, FL, US under ownership by Benedictus Holdings LLC, the airframe is suited to executive transport and on-demand charter roles consistent with its size and interior fit. Maintenance considerations noted in listings emphasize common Learjet 60 logistics and the need to track component programs for its twin PW305A engines; specific maintenance history for this serial is not published.

The Learjet 60 occupies a midsize, light-to-medium business jet niche within the Learjet/Bombardier family, combining relatively high cruise speeds and transcontinental capability for its class. Competitors in mission profile and cabin size include other light midsize business jets; buyer and charter demand for a 2002 airframe is influenced by interior condition and avionics, both of which are documented for this airframe. Resale and maintenance considerations for this specific airframe center on continued engine shop visit tracking for the PW305A engines and lifecycle status for avionics such as the Rockwell Collins Pro Line 21.
